Across TCGA patient cohorts, SRPK3 mutation is significantly associated with the total protein of many other genes, with 31 significant associations in total. UCEC shows the largest number of these associations.

The most reproducible SRPK3-associated genes across cancer lineages are 14-3-3_beta, VHL, and ATM. Each is linked with SRPK3 in more than 1 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both SRPK3-to-partner and partner-to-SRPK3 results are reported.
